#include <IRremote.h>
#define boton1 0xEA150820 // Boton usado para el control remoto usado en clase
#define boton2 0xEA150821 // Los número decodificados seran distintos para cada control
int sensor = 22;
void setup() {
Serial.begin(9600);
IrReceiver.begin(sensor,DISABLE_LED_FEEDBACK);
}
void loop() {
if(IrReceiver.decode()){
Serial.println(IrReceiver.decodedIRData.decodedRawData, HEX);
if(IrReceiver.decodedIRData.decodedRawData == boton1){
Serial.println("señal recibida"); // Codigo para boton 1
}
if(IrReceiver.decodedIRData.decodedRawData == boton2){
Serial.println("señal recibida"); // Codigo para boton 2
}
IrReceiver.resume();
}
delay(100);
}